Have you ever wondered what it was like to live in the 1960s? Timeline is the Weird History channel's prestige documentary series that examines history, decade by decade and year by year, covering the people, news, culture, sports, and entertainment that defined the past and shaped the world we live in today. In this episode we look at 1968, the year Martin Luther King was assassinated, George Foreman won Olympic Gold, and Mister Rogers’ Neighborhood made its debut.
